Federal OSHA recorded a severe workplace injury
at Child Saving Institute (CSI), 4545 Dodge Street, OMAHA, NEBRASKA 68132
on — Fractures (except skull fractures) and concussions , affecting the head and trunk.
Final narrative
An employee was working on a ladder over a playground stage. The employee fell from the ladder to the stage; he was hospitalized with eight broken ribs and a concussion.
